...Randy Beavers at our Georgia Peach Jam, June 12th at the Hollonville Opry House, Hollonville, GA! Randy will be debuting his new CD as well as fascinating us with his flawless delivery and impecable style. We're currently talking to several other monster players that have not confirmed yet. Combine that with the talent we have in our membership, and it will be another great Jam. We also welcome guest players to join us, just let us know you so we can add you to our play list. And our staff band...you just can't say enough about them! All are encouraged to come join us for a day of great music and fellowship. For the golfers in the crowd, we are planning a golf outing for Saturday, June 11th. Come join us for both! I will need advance notice if you plan to participate in golf so the arrangements can be made. I hear Randy is quite a golfer, better put him on my team! Mark your calendar! Regards, Roger Crawford President GaSGA [This message was edited by Roger Crawford on 06 April 2005 at 02:51 PM.] |
